How To Train Your Dragon... to kick ass at the box office!
I know this is old news, but I just wanted to gloat about the amazing success of How To Train Your Dragon. It opened with a 43 million dollar weekend and was considered a disappointment by industry insiders because it didn't open as well as Dreamworks' last 3D movie, Monsters Vs. Aliens. MvA went on to make $198,351,526. Dragon has made $202,644,160 as of today and is still in the top 5 for weekend box office after 7 weeks. It actually reclaimed the no. 1 weekend spot on its 5th weekend of release.
